Clipboard broken in UWP apps only
As far as I could tell it's a UWP app specific issue (ie calculator, file explorer, paint3D). Nothing happens in these apps when i try to paste something, calculator even crashes if i try to copy, and I know nothing gets put into the clipboard as the last thing i copied from a non-UWP app is still possible to paste in other non-UWP apps. I verified this using powershell with the Get-Clipboard command. Notepad works fine, but afaik it's not UWP. I do have a custom UWP notepad installed (https://github.com/0x7c13/Notepads) which DOES have this issue.

I wrote my bibliography manually (Dont ask why). How do I sort it by the first letter of each entry?
you sort the lines with a good text editor. Notepad++ for example has a function Edit -> Line Operations -> Sort Lines Lexicographically Ascending / Descending. In Emacs you mark the block and run M-x sort-lines. In vim, you mark the block and run :sort.
